Q: Is 58,261,484 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 58,261,484 is a composite number.

Why is 58,261,484 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 58,261,484 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 23 46 92 503 1,006 1,259 2,012 2,518 5,036 11,569 23,138 28,957 46,276 57,914 115,828 633,277 1,266,554 2,533,108 14,565,371 29,130,742 and 58,261,484, with no remainder.

Since 58,261,484 cannot be divided by just 1 and 58,261,484, it is a composite number.
